A few days ago, what appears to be the first coin of a new series entitled “Flora and Fauna” was issued in Italy, the first piece of which is dedicated to “La Margarita”. This collection is made up of one-ounce silver coins with a face value of 0.25 euros. Although I do not yet have official information confirming that this is a completely new series, various unofficial sources indicate that this is the case.
The Coin
Two enchanting images blossom on the surface of this one-ounce pure silver coin, paying beautiful homage to the natural world: a resplendent daisy, a symbol of light and purity, and a splendid woman's face, the personification of Italian flora, crowned by flowers and olive and oak branches.
Obverse: Daisy flowers stand out in the centre, with the scientific name “LEUCANTHEMUM” on the left. On the right, the year of issue, “2025”, and the “R” mark, which identifies the Mint of Rome, appear. Around the edge, the inscription “ITALIAN REPUBLIC” surrounds the scene. At the bottom, a rhombus with the author’s signature, “A.MASINI”, is shown as the designer’s signature on the obverse.
Reverse: In the centre, a female face with thick hair surrounded by a wreath of various species of flowers. To the left of the wreath, an olive branch is shown together with the inscription “0.25EURO”, the coin’s face value; to the right, an oak branch. In the upper left corner, the word “FLORA” appears and in the lower right corner, “1 oz Ag 999”, separated by a rhombus. At the bottom, the author’s signature on the reverse, “M.CIUCCI”, completes the design.
Technical characteristics of the coin and its issuance
Country Italy
Year 2025
Face Value 0.25 Euros
Metal 999 Silver
Design Annalisa Masini and Monica Ciucci
Weight 31.10 g
Diameter 38.61 mm
Quality BU
Throw 16,000
The selling price of this coin in Italy is 65 euros.
